Transaction 3b693603b3e0f949eb64fffb965ebede1df251107d7d5c51b2110a2748517765
1 Input
1 Output
-
3b693603b3e0f949eb64fffb965ebede1df251107d7d5c51b2110a2748517765:0
- value
- 530083
- script pubkey
- OP_0 OP_PUSHBYTES_20 32b7a3d3ca25034b71b35ece87656b899e80e055
- address
- bc1qx2m68572y5p5kudntm8gwett3x0gpcz4evqqad